102103321267 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 102103321268. Its totient is φ = 102103321266.
The previous prime is 102103321259. The next prime is 102103321303. The reversal of 102103321267 is 762123301201.
It is a weak prime.
It is an emirp because it is prime and its reverse (762123301201) is a distict pr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 102103321267 - 23 = 102103321259 is a prime.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(102103321867)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 51051660633 + 51051660634.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(51051660634).
Almost surely, 2102103321267 is an apocalyptic number.
102103321267 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
102103321267 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
102103321267 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 3024, while the sum is 28.
Adding to 102103321267 its reverse (762123301201), we get a palindrome (864226622468).
